Okay, I totally get the comic sans snobbery, but the thing is that it has an a that is shaped like the way most people write an a, okay? And for my asylum seeking students that is awesome because wtf how do you know that a is not a different letter to the a most people draw? So my use of comic sans is actually a practical application of available tools.
